Announcements

  • Of the 178 April visitors, 109 hailed from Virginia, 68 from 18 other states, and 1 from Australia.
     
  • One Gloucester High School senior donated 4 hours service as a junior docent in April.
     
  • A reception remembering and honoring WWII veterans will be held at the Museum on D-Day, Sunday, June 6 at
    2:30 P.M. WWII veterans & relatives, relatives of deceased veterans, and families of those who lost their
    lives during the war are invited. Guests will have the opportunity to view the military exhibit, renew old
    acquaintances, and reminisce their wartime experiences.
